SUMMARY
DO NOT MISS OUT...this extended three bedroom link detached property will attract early interest. Located within the sought after area of South Anston and is offered for sale with NO UPWARD CHAIN. Ideally placed for amenities, schools and transport and good commuting links.


DESCRIPTION
Occupying a head of cul de sac position is this extended three bedroom link detached house worthy of an early inspection. Ideal family home located within the increasingly popular area of South Anston. The village has a host of shops and amenities and excellent schools. Also convenient for motorway commuting to Sheffield, Worksop, Rotherham and Doncaster. The property comprises, lounge, dining room, extended kitchen and sun lounge, three bedrooms and bathroom. An added benefit is the 41ft attached garage and private lawned garden to the rear. We are confident that this property will prove to be popular so an early inspection is recommended.
